			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/01/tool-2.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-2179" title="tool-2" src="http://pspslimhacks.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/01/tool-2.jpg" alt="tool-2" width="150" height="226" /></a>Datel have told Portable Video Gamer that Sony is taking legal action against their lite blue <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/tool/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with tool">tool</a>. The <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/tool/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with tool">tool</a> advertised to be able to hack the PSP-3000. This answer came just after Portable Video Gamer asked Datel why the Lite blue <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/tool/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with tool">tool</a> was removed and later the description changed.</p>
<p>Datel&#8217;s response:</p>
<blockquote><p>Due to legal action by Sony Computer Entertainment Europe we are currently not able to fulfil orders for the Lite Blue <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/tool/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with tool">Tool</a> <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/battery/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with battery">Battery</a>. Any orders received for this product have not been processed and no charges have been made. We will inform customers about availability of this product when this situation has been resolved.</p></blockquote>
<p>So why is Sony taking Datel to court? Purhaps Datel did infact crack the PSP-3000 and natually Sony wish to put a hold to it. Maybe copyright infringement? What do you think?</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>But not by Dark~AleX. Guess who?</p>
<p>Datel out of all people have &#8220;cracked&#8221; the PSP-3000 and booted it with a new <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/tool/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with tool">TOOL</a> <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/battery/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with battery">battery</a>.</p>
<div id="attachment_1994" class="wp-caption aligncenter" style="width: 224px"><a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/wp-content/uploads/2008/11/300_4.jpg"><img class="size-full wp-image-1994" src="http://pspslimhacks.com/wp-content/uploads/2008/11/300_4.jpg" alt="Lite Blue TOOL" width="214" height="306"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Lite Blue <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/tool/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with tool">TOOL</a></p></div>
<p>Compatible with the PSP-2000 and 3000, it goes for  $19.99 in the UK and $29.99 in North America late this month.</p>
<p>BUT! There&#8217;s a catch. This <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/battery/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with battery">battery</a> doesn&#8217;t actually install CFW on your PSP.<br />
From Alek:</p>
<blockquote><p>1. To have a LED indicator ON, doesn&#8217;t means that you can install cfw or hack anything. Remember 088v3 mobos? Right.<br />
2. It&#8217;s spreading like a timebomb that it can be hacked and so on. Well, what any user can see is an interesting campaign to promote an article that is not yet released. It would be interesting to see.. how about an old &#8220;hello world&#8221; like on Noobz time, instead of a &#8220;buy today&#8221; call?<br />
3. Just to remember all this things up, LED indicator ON and nothing on screen means directly what Dark_AleX explained <a href="http://www.dark-alex.org/forum/viewtopic.php?f=44&amp;t=1194" target="_blank">here</a> about the preIPL.</p></blockquote>
<p>So, don&#8217;t be tricked by another scam by Datel to steal your money kids!.</p>

<p>Remember Datel&#8217;s <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/attention-cheaters-action-replay-is-now-on-the-psp/">Action Replay</a> for the PSP? Upon inspection by Dark_AleX and VoidPointer, it appears that the $40 device actually contains the IPL used in Pandora within the supplied memory stick.</p>
<blockquote><p>Datel&#8217; <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/action-replay/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with action replay">Action Replay</a> does uses code that isn&#8217;t from itself, code that isn&#8217;t distributed to be used the way they use it anyway. The code involving this terms is, for first instance, the <strong>Pandora forged IPL block</strong>, and on second place but of course not less important, <strong>Booster&#8217;s IPL SDK</strong>.</p></blockquote>
<p>Datel doesn&#8217;t seem to give any credit to the original Pandora developers at all.</p>
<p>Here&#8217;s some more interesting things to note; from Alek&#8217;s blog:</p>
<blockquote>
<ul>
<li>It has been confirmed that Datel&#8217; <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/tag/action-replay/" class="st_tag internal_tag" rel="tag" title="Posts tagged with action replay">Action replay</a> does <strong>interfere</strong> on the Custom Firmware code</li>
<li>They use a bigger memory footprint due to the graphics involved in it, and it&#8217;s interesting also to mention that they had a pretty small database, that being compared it to cwcheat one, this first one isn&#8217;t even a database tbh.</li>
</ul>
</blockquote>
<p>So what do you think?<br />
I suggest sticking to <a href="http://pspslimhacks.com/cwcheat-022-rev-d/">CWCheat</a> for those who have CFW.</p>
